Vision of Beauty: The Story of Sarah Breedlove Walker by Kathryn Lasky is an ideal text for celebrating African American History month and teaching entrepreneurship. This is an original lesson plan on the life of Madame C.J. Walker, who defied the odds, and in spite of growing up poor and orphaned, became the first African American woman millionaire, civil rights supporter/activist, philanthropist, and an extremely successful entrepreneur. Madame C.J. Walker's life was hard, but she overcame it

This activity pairs nicely with a Jackie Robinson biography like A Picture Book of Jackie Robinson by David A. Adler or I Am Jackie Robinson by Brad Meltzer. It could also work well with the Pebble Go article on Jackie Robinson. Students draw a picture of Jackie Robinson on the front like on a real baseball card. On the back they record his birthday, team, and 3 interesting facts.
